微博转发按钮高级使用指南
需积分: 10 14 浏览量
更新于2024-09-17
收藏 2.15MB PDF 举报
"新浪微博组件_转发按钮使用说明"
在互联网上,社交媒体分享已经成为网站流量和用户互动的重要驱动力。本文主要关注的是如何在网站上集成新浪微博的转发按钮,以促进内容的传播并增加用户参与度。新浪微博组件的转发按钮使得用户能够轻松地将网页内容分享到他们的微博账户,同时为没有微博账号的用户提供了一个低门槛的分享途径。
**转发按钮的功能与优势**
1. **内容传播**: 转发按钮让用户能够将网页上的各种内容,包括带有图片的信息,快速分享到自己的微博上,增加了内容的曝光率。
2. **注册门槛降低**: 对于未注册微博的用户,通过转发按钮分享内容时,无需注册即可进行简单的分享操作。
3. **第三方集成**: 提供了方便的API和代码,使得第三方网站能够轻松集成转发功能。
4. **数据统计**: 提供转发数的显示,并且通过接口可以获取相关的分享统计数据,帮助网站分析用户行为。
**如何使用转发按钮**
1. **简易方式**: 适合对网站定制需求不高的用户,只需引入一段预设的代码,样式和功能相对固定。代码获取地址为:`http://t.sina.com.cn/plugins/sharebutton.php`。
2. **高级方式**: 这种方式提供了更多的自定义选项,适用于合作网站、大型网站或具有开发能力的站点。下面将详细介绍这种高级使用方法。
**高级使用说明**
要实现高级的转发功能,需要使用如下基本代码结构:
```html
http://v.t.sina.com.cn/share/share.php?url=xxx&appkey=xxx&title=xxx&pic=xxx&content=xxx&source=xxx&sourceUrl=xxx
```
其中,各参数的含义如下:
- `url`: 必填,转发内容的URL,应为被分享页面的实际URL。
- `appkey`: 建议必填,由开发者申请的appkey,用于显示内容来源,默认为空。
- `title`: 转发内容的文本,默认取被分享页面的title,可以自定义。
- `pic`: 图片地址,如果将服务器加入白名单,可以转发原图;默认只转发用户选择的图片缩略图。
- `content`: 页面编码,已过时,不应再使用。
- `source`: 来源显示的文字,建议使用appkey显示来源,已过时,不应再使用。
- `sourceUrl`: 来源的URL,已过时,不应再使用。
**推荐示例**
为了控制转发窗口的打开,可以使用以下JavaScript示例,创建一个点击后弹出小窗口的转发链接:
```html
<a href="javascript:(function(){window.open('http://v.t.sina.com.cn/share/share.php?appkey=xxx&url='+encodeURIComponent(location.href),'_blank','width=615,height=505');})()">转发到新浪微博</a>
```
这段代码会打开一个宽度为615像素、高度为505像素的小窗口,用于转发当前页面到微博。
通过灵活运用这些参数和示例代码,开发者可以根据自己的需求定制微博转发按钮,以优化用户体验并提高网站的社交媒体影响力。同时,对于希望获取更详尽信息的开发者,可以参考新浪微博提供的相关文档和附录,以了解appkey的申请方法和图片服务器白名单的设置等具体细节。
2012-03-24 上传
2012-10-28 上传
2014-08-08 上传
2011-11-27 上传
2016-04-10 上传
2019-03-31 上传
2021-04-01 上传
2011-11-18 上传
2014-04-01 上传
starstarstone
- 粉丝: 19
- 资源: 9
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章